There is a huge disparity between the rich and the poor in Hong Kong. The failure of parents to get rid of poverty also affects the chances of upward mobility of children, forming a vicious circle of intergenerational poverty.

Chan Kung Wai-ying, chairman of the "Child Development Matching Fund" and "Youth Development Enterprise Alliance", said in a radio program today (11th) that the current "exam-oriented" education system fails to tap the potential and interests of young people, and parents do not have the money to provide other High-quality educational resources and connections make grassroots children lack opportunities for upward mobility when they grow up.


She mentioned that the workplace education program launched by the organization she leads has provided thousands of grassroots young people with the opportunity to enter the workplace and try their hand at making new cuts in the workplace, allowing them to plan their lives as early as possible.

She hopes that after the new government takes office, it can implement the policy of solving the problem of poverty alleviation across generations as soon as possible, and prescribe the right medicine for the youth at the grassroots level to get rid of poverty.

Chen Gongweiying said in the Hong Kong TV program "Hong Kong Family Letter" that according to the poverty report in Hong Kong the previous year, the number of poor children has been increasing, and before the government's policy intervention, it was as high as 270,000, that is, every 4 children under the age of 18. , one is a poor child, and Hong Kong's Gini coefficient continues to rise, which also shows that the problem of the disparity between the rich and the poor in Hong Kong is still serious.

She believes that due to parental and family factors, young people at the grassroots level lack high-quality educational resources and opportunities for upward mobility, forming a vicious circle of intergenerational poverty.

Regarding the social tendency to use financial support to help the grassroots get rid of poverty, she mentioned that she has served as the chairman of the "Child Development Matching Fund" for many years, and believes that the key to solving the problem of poverty alleviation across generations is to help these grassroots young people to move upward, that is, to equip them well The ability to move upwards and open up related opportunities.

In order to find the right medicine, she mentioned that the “Youth Development Enterprise Alliance” she leads has launched the “Y-WE Youth Work Experience” pilot program 8 years ago, targeting low-level middle school students as a priority, providing them with comprehensive and systematic workplace education, inspiring Students’ interests and potential will be linked with the government, schools, social welfare and business sectors, providing ample opportunities for grassroots students, so that they can have the opportunity to have practical workplace experience as early as secondary school, learn about the society, get in touch with the business sector, Build personal connections and exercise soft power in the workplace to enhance your understanding of your potential and interests.

Chen Gongweiying continued that the program has helped more than 1,300 young people at the grassroots level, emphasizing that "I have never met a young person with no ability or potential, only young people with low self-confidence or undiscovered talents."

She hopes that after the new government takes office, it can implement policies to solve cross-generational poverty alleviation as soon as possible, including rethinking the nature of education, and attaching importance to workplace education alongside academic education, so as to help young people achieve upward mobility, so as to achieve get rid of poverty.
